Coffee Meets Bagel's AI Fraud Detection: A Trust Play or a Credibility Risk?
Key Points
- •Coffee Meets Bagel recorded an 81% selfie verification completion rate among active global users within three months of rolling out the feature.
- •Eighty per cent of Coffee Meets Bagel members in Singapore verified their accounts using Singpass, the city-state's national digital identity framework.
- •Coffee Meets Bagel deployed AI-powered fraud detection combined with human review and dual-layer identity verification across its global dating platform.
- •Coffee Meets Bagel claimed to be the first dating platform in Singapore to integrate government-issued Singpass digital identity verification into its application.
Coffee Meets Bagel has deployed AI-powered fraud detection and dual-layer identity verification across its platform, combining machine learning systems designed to spot AI-generated profile images with human review and national digital identity integration in Singapore. The timing isn't coincidental. Generative AI tools have made fake profile creation trivially easy, forcing dating platforms into an arms race between AI-enabled deception and AI-powered detection, with member trust hanging in the balance.
This is what defensive product strategy looks like when your category faces an existential trust crisis.
CMB's layered approach—AI detection, selfie verification, national ID integration where available, human moderation as backstop—reflects the reality that no single verification method suffices against determined fraudsters with LLMs and image generators. The 81% verification uptake is impressive, though it raises the obvious question: what happens to the 19% who won't verify? If they're removed, that's meaningful friction. If they're not, the system leaks credibility.
When National Identity Infrastructure Meets Dating Apps
Singapore's Singpass integration represents something Match Group hasn't meaningfully pursued at scale: tying dating profiles to government-issued digital identity. The 80% adoption rate suggests members accept—or perhaps expect—this level of verification in markets where national digital ID systems command broad trust. The contrast with CMB's global selfie verification approach is instructive.

Selfie systems ask members to submit a real-time photo matched against profile images using biometric analysis. Singpass, by comparison, connects profiles to Singapore's national identity database, the same system used for tax filing, healthcare access, and banking. One approach proves you look like your photos. The other proves you are who you claim to be, full stop.
CMB claims to be the first dating app in Singapore to integrate Singpass, a statement the company has made publicly but which we haven't independently verified across all platforms operating in the market. Whether first or not, the move signals a willingness to embrace regulatory-grade identity verification ahead of any mandate. That positioning could prove valuable if Singapore's regulators—or others—eventually require such measures.
The regulatory dimension matters more than it might appear. Whilst the UK Online Safety Act focuses on age verification and illegal content, and the EU Digital Services Act emphasises transparency and content moderation, neither framework currently mandates identity verification for dating platforms. Singapore's approach, characteristically, may prove more prescriptive. CMB's proactive integration positions it favourably if verification requirements tighten.
The AI Detection Problem Nobody's Solved
CMB says its AI model screens photos to identify AI-generated imagery before profiles reach members. This sounds reassuring until you consider the state of AI detection technology. The technical reality: detection models lag behind generation models, often significantly. As generative tools improve—and they improve rapidly—detection systems struggle to keep pace.
Research from multiple labs shows AI-generated image detectors producing false positives on heavily filtered or edited real photos, whilst missing synthetic images that have been subtly post-processed. The arms race dynamics favour the attackers. A fraudster can iterate through generation models and post-processing techniques until something passes detection. The platform must catch every attempt.
Deployed as one layer in a multi-step verification system, AI detection raises the cost and complexity for bad actors, but presented as a solved problem rather than an ongoing challenge, it overpromises.
CMB's broader safety architecture acknowledges this limitation by design. The platform layers AI detection with message moderation, behaviour monitoring for harassment and location spoofing, reputation systems, and human review. No single intervention stops fraud; the combination raises barriers high enough to deter most casual bad actors whilst flagging sophisticated ones for human investigation.
Competitive Implications for the Verification Arms Race
For smaller platforms competing against Match Group's portfolio and Bumble, safety and verification increasingly function as table stakes rather than differentiators. Members now expect some form of identity verification. The question becomes how much friction platforms impose, and whether that friction meaningfully reduces fraud without suppressing growth.
CMB's 81% verification rate within three months suggests members tolerate—or perhaps welcome—the additional step when positioned as a trust-building measure. That uptake rate compares favourably to industry norms, though direct comparisons remain difficult given limited public disclosure from competitors. Match Group properties have rolled out various verification features across Tinder, Hinge, and other brands, but haven't published comparable adoption metrics.
The competitive angle sharpens around what happens to unverified profiles. Platforms face a trade-off: allowing unverified members preserves member counts and revenue but undermines the verification system's credibility. Restricting or removing unverified profiles protects trust but shrinks the network and potentially throttles growth. CMB hasn't publicly detailed its policy for members who decline verification, which matters considerably for assessing the system's actual impact.
Verification becomes a more potent competitive weapon if platforms not only verify identities but also communicate verification status clearly and allow members to filter by verified-only. That transforms verification from a background trust mechanism into an explicit member preference, which in turn creates pressure on unverified profiles to either verify or exit. Whether CMB has implemented such filtering isn't clear from company statements.
What Operators Should Watch
The efficacy gap between AI-powered fraud detection and AI-enabled fraud creation will continue widening before detection catches up, if it ever fully does. Platforms relying solely on automated systems will find themselves outpaced. Human review remains expensive but necessary for sophisticated fraud cases.
Regulatory appetite for mandatory identity verification is growing, particularly in markets with existing national digital ID infrastructure. Singapore may represent a template for other jurisdictions. Operators in markets with established digital identity frameworks should anticipate verification mandates and consider proactive integration before regulation forces reactive compliance.
Member expectations around verification are shifting faster than many platforms acknowledge. The dating industry's trust crisis—amplified by generative AI—has primed members to expect proof of identity. Platforms that frame verification as optional or experimental may find themselves outflanked by competitors who make it mandatory and visible.
